When Do People Get Their Retainers?

First things first, your retainer is not just a fashion accessory. It’s a vital component in maintaining the results of your Invisalign treatment. After your teeth have been shifted into their new positions, there’s a tendency for them to want to revert back to their original placement. This is where your retainer swoops in to save the day.

How Long Will I Wear my Retainer at a Time?

Typically, orthodontists recommend wearing your retainer full-time immediately after completing your Invisalign treatment. Yes, that means nearly 24/7 wear, except for when eating and brushing your teeth. This intensive wear schedule helps solidify the new alignment of your teeth and prevents any unwanted shifting.

After a few months of full-time wear, your orthodontist may give you the green light to switch to wearing your retainer only at night. This phase can last for several months to a year, depending on your individual case and the recommendation of your orthodontist.

Even after transitioning to wearing your retainer only at night, it’s essential to remain diligent. Consistency is key to maintaining that straight smile you’ve worked so hard for. Skipping nights or forgetting to wear your retainer can result in minor shifts that may require additional orthodontic treatment to correct.

When Can I Ease Off of My Retainer?

So, when can you finally bid farewell to your retainer? Well, it depends. Some patients need to keep wearing their retainer indefinitely, while others can say goodbye after a certain period of time.

Remember, every smile is unique, and the duration of retainer wear may vary from person to person. Factors such as the complexity of your initial alignment issues and the elasticity of your gums and surrounding tissues can influence how long you’ll need to wear your retainer. You’ll need to talk to your dentist to determine for sure how long retainer use will be necessary.
